Function of Repeaters in Fiber Optic Communication Systems

Fiber optic repeaters regenerate and amplify optical signals to extend the reach and maintain the integrity of long-distance fiber optic communication links.

Core Function

Fiber optic repeaters are essential devices in optical communication systems that counteract signal degradation caused by attenuation and dispersion as light travels through optical fibers . Without repeaters, signals weaken over distance, leading to errors or loss of data. Repeaters restore the signal's amplitude, shape, and timing, ensuring reliable transmission across long-haul terrestrial or undersea networks .

Types of Repeaters

  1. Electro-Optical-Electro (O-E-O) Repeaters These repeaters convert the optical signal into an electrical signal, amplify and reshape it electronically, and then convert it back to optical form. This method allows precise correction of signal distortion and timing errors but can be limited by electronic bandwidth and higher power consumption .
  2. All-Optical Repeaters (Optical Amplifiers) All-optical repeaters, such as Erbium-Doped Fiber Amplifiers (EDFAs) and Raman amplifiers, amplify the optical signal directly without converting it to electrical form. This approach supports higher bandwidths, is more power-efficient, and integrates easily into Wavelength Division Multiplexing (WDM) systems, allowing multiple wavelengths to be amplified simultaneously .

Signal Regeneration Categories

Optical repeaters can perform different levels of signal regeneration, classified by the 3 R's scheme:

  • 1R (Reamplification): Boosts signal power without correcting shape or timing.
  • 2R (Reamplification + Reshaping): Restores signal amplitude and corrects pulse distortion.
  • 3R (Reamplification + Reshaping + Retiming): Fully regenerates the signal, including timing synchronization, ideal for long-haul high-speed networks .

Applications

Repeaters are critical in:

  • Long-distance terrestrial fiber links, where installation and maintenance are relatively easier.
  • Undersea fiber optic cables, where repeaters are more complex due to maintenance challenges and higher installation costs .
  • High-speed data networks and WDM systems, enabling multiple channels to transmit over a single fiber without significant signal loss .

Summary

In essence, fiber optic repeaters extend communication distances, maintain signal quality, and enable high-bandwidth, long-haul optical networks. The choice between electro-optical and all-optical repeaters depends on network requirements, cost, and efficiency considerations, with all-optical amplifiers increasingly preferred for modern WDM systems due to their scalability and lower power consumption .
